Need Help

Just recently was given a tractor from my in-laws that were sitting outside under a tarp for about five years untouched.
I got it and cleaned all the filters and gas tank and bought a battery. To my amazement it started right up.
I cut the lawn twice with it and it ran fine until the other day.
I turned the tractor off and when I went to restart it, and it just clicked. And If I hold the key in it just “clicks” but wouldn’t turn over. So I attempted to manually rotate the (crank?) thing on the top of the motor (mesh looking thing) that normally spins when the tractor is running and it would only rotate half way around and then it felt like it was hitting something. I’ve been looking around to see if it’s hitting anything but it’s not.
Is the motor seized?
